Cutting Sugar Improves Children`s Health in Just 10 Days
... drinks and foods mainly what contributes to illness over the long term? In the new study, which was financed by the National Institutes of Health and published Tuesday in the journal Obesity, scientists designed a clinical experiment to attempt to answer this question. Nutritional Considerations
... Avoid sugary foods right before exercise Allow plenty of time for food to digest – 3-4 hours for a large meal – 2-3 hours for a smaller meal – 1-2 hours for a snack Liquid foods leave stomach faster than solids Always eat familiar foods before competition Drink plenty of fluids before competition ...

Diet Myths and Food Trends
... major concern with the glycemic index is that it ranks foods in isolation. But in reality, how your body absorbs and handles carbs depends on many factors, including how much you eat; how the food is ripened, processed or prepared; the time of day it's eaten; other foods you eat it with; and health ...
